Detailed Engineering Specifications

A proven choice for industrial professionals, this brass stock sheet is manufactured to exacting standards for hydraulic applications. With a precise thickness of 0.240 inches and dimensions of 18 inches by 38 inches, it provides a substantial material base for fabricating critical hydraulic parts. Brass exhibits excellent resistance to corrosion, particularly from water and many hydraulic fluids, ensuring longevity and reliability. Its favorable thermal conductivity aids in heat dissipation within hydraulic circuits, and its inherent strength supports the pressures typical of these systems.

Chemical Composition

Copper (Cu)60.0 - 63.0%
Zinc (Zn)Balance
Lead (Pb)2.5 - 3.7%

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using incorrect cutting tools leading to burrs or uneven edges.Employ specialized metal cutting tools and ensure blades are sharp. Always deburr edges after cutting.
Failing to account for thermal expansion during machining or assembly.Allow for expansion gaps where critical, especially in high-temperature hydraulic systems.
